What Are Pleated Blinds?
Voldikardinad are window coverings made from a single piece of pleated fabric. These blinds are designed to fold neatly when raised, allowing a clear view of the outdoors, and to unfold smoothly to cover windows when lowered, providing privacy and light control. Their unique structure creates a clean, crisp appearance, adding an elegant touch to any room.
Pleated blinds are available in a variety of colors, fabrics, and patterns, making them a versatile choice for different interior design styles. Whether you prefer a bold, vibrant look or a more subtle, neutral tone, pleated blinds offer something for everyone. They are also suitable for various window types, including standard windows, skylights, and even uniquely shaped windows, making them an ideal solution for any home.
Benefits of Pleated Blinds
- Light Control and Privacy
One of the key benefits of pleated blinds is their ability to control natural light. By adjusting the height of the blinds, you can easily regulate the amount of sunlight entering your room. This flexibility allows you to create the perfect ambiance, whether you want a bright, airy atmosphere during the day or a cozy, private space in the evening.
Pleated blinds also offer excellent privacy. When fully lowered, they provide a barrier that prevents outsiders from seeing into your home while still allowing soft, diffused light to enter. This makes them an excellent choice for bedrooms, bathrooms, and other areas where privacy is a priority.
- Energy Efficiency
Pleated blinds can also contribute to the energy efficiency of your home. The pleated design creates air pockets that help to insulate your windows, keeping your home cooler in the summer and warmer in the winter. By reducing the need for heating and cooling, pleated blinds can help lower your energy bills and make your home more environmentally friendly.
For even greater energy efficiency, consider pleated blinds with a honeycomb structure. These blinds have additional layers that provide enhanced insulation, making them an excellent choice for energy-conscious homeowners.
- Versatility and Style
Pleated blinds are known for their versatility. They come in a wide range of fabrics, including light-filtering and blackout options, allowing you to choose the level of light control that best suits your needs. Light-filtering pleated blinds are perfect for living areas where you want to maintain a bright and welcoming atmosphere, while blackout pleated blinds are ideal for bedrooms where complete darkness is desired.
In terms of style, pleated blinds offer a modern, minimalist look that complements a variety of interior design themes. Their sleek lines and compact design make them an excellent choice for small spaces, as they do not take up much room when raised. Additionally, pleated blinds can be customized to fit uniquely shaped windows, providing a tailored look that enhances the overall aesthetic of your home.
